Codium AI is an advanced, quality-first AI-powered code integrity solution tailored for developers seeking to enhance their coding efficiency and accuracy. By utilizing sophisticated Retrieval Augmented Generation (RAG) techniques, Codium AI comprehensively analyzes and understands the unique context of an organization’s codebase. This ensures that the AI-generated code is not only high-quality but also aligns seamlessly with existing coding practices and standards.
Features
Codium AI boasts a robust set of features designed to facilitate various aspects of code generation, testing, and review. The following table outlines the specific features available:
Feature | Description |
---|---|
Comprehensive Code Analysis | Analyzes code for bugs, inefficiencies, and adherence to standards, providing actionable insights. |
Automated Code Reviews | Automates code reviews to detect code smells and vulnerabilities, offering constructive feedback. |
Intelligent Code Suggestions | Provides suggestions for code improvements and optimizations, including algorithm enhancements. |
Interactive Chat Functionality | Offers a chat interface for code cleaning, bug detection, vulnerability identification, and documentation. |
Customizable Test Creation | Automatically generates test suites with the ability to modify tests and self-debug failed tests. |
Enterprise-Specific Solutions | Features a dynamic best practices database that learns and reinforces enterprise-specific coding standards. |
Flexible Deployment Options | Offers cloud, on-prem, and air-gapped deployment options to meet diverse security requirements. |
Holistic Overview Dashboard | Includes a dashboard for tracking usage metrics and understanding AI coding impact on quality and efficiency. |
Use cases
Codium AI can be employed across various scenarios, including:
- Enhancing Code Reviews: Teams can utilize automated code reviews to ensure code quality and adherence to standards, significantly reducing the manual effort required.
- Optimizing Code Efficiency: Developers can receive real-time suggestions for improving complex code segments, leading to cleaner and more maintainable code.
- Generating Test Cases: Codium AI can automatically create comprehensive test suites, covering both typical and edge-case scenarios, which helps in maintaining robust software quality.
- Enterprise Compliance: Organizations can benefit from the dynamic best practices database, ensuring that all generated code complies with their specific coding standards.
- Streamlining Collaboration: The interactive chat feature enables team members to engage in discussions around code integrity, facilitating better communication and collaboration.
How to get started
To get started with Codium AI, developers can explore the platform through a trial option or access the GitHub repository for additional resources. For further inquiries, interested users are encouraged to reach out directly to the Codium AI support team for guidance on implementation and usage.
</section>
<section>
Codium AI Pricing Plans
Pricing is structured with a free tier and additional plans for developers, teams, and enterprises.
- Free Tier: Available, but some features are not included.
- Developer Plan: Pricing not available.
- Teams Plan: Pricing not available.
- Enterprise Plan: Pricing not available.